Survival

Description:

Survival refers to the act or process of staying alive or existing despite difficult or challenging circumstances. It can also refer to the ability to adapt and endure under adverse conditions.

Senses:

  1. Noun: The state or fact of continuing to live or exist; the act of surviving.
  2. Noun: The techniques, skills, and knowledge necessary for staying alive in dangerous or hostile environments.
  3. Adjective: Pertaining to survival or the ability to survive.
  4. Verb: To continue to live or exist; to remain alive.
